Vanguard Mid-Cap Value ETF

178 hedge funds and large institutions have $1.39B invested in Vanguard Mid-Cap Value ETF in 2014 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 21 funds opening new positions, 81 increasing their positions, 40 reducing their positions, and 14 closing their positions.
